String processing function library Strpos Searches for the first occurrence of a character in a string. Syntax: Int strpos (string haystack, string needle, int [offset]); Return Value:Integer Function types:Data Processing
This function is used to find the first position where the character needle in the haystack string appears. It is worth noting that the needle can only be one character, and it is not suitable for Chinese characters. If the specified character is not found, false is returned. The offset parameter can be omitted, which is used to start searching from offset.
